Ortho is a great field....For the most part great folks, but also lots of outpatient procedures....Pedisurg is a very limiting career. Very few outpatient procedures, which means in today medicoeconomic scene you are screwed. You will only be able to find positions where there is enough need for a pedisurg....i don't know the numbers off the top of my head, but something like 75k persons per pedisurg.......If you stay at an academic center you will be at the beck and call of the PICU/NICU for line changes and many little cases which pay about zero dollars, and always seem to get put on the add-on schedule and who knows when they will happen. Unless you are doing pedi hearts, most pedisurgeons are severely underpaid...stick in ortho, do a pedi fellowship if you like....the job market is much better, and you will avolid lots of headaches..
